Having got onto this topic perhaps someone can help me out. The
Tories are against closer integration into Europe claiming loss of
sovereignty etc. If that is really the case why are they also
against returning sovereignty to Scotland and Wales?


I'd guess it's because they're Conservatives, e.g. content with the
status quo. This includes the unwritten constitution which
centralizes all power in the Crown, and therefore in the government
at Westminster. Therefore moving power to Edinburgh is just as
offensive as moving power to Brussels - because it detracts from
the Sovreignty of Parliament.


But the Scots (notionally anyway) chose to give up their sovereignty
to the English Parliament and become part of the United Kingdom. So
what's wrong with returning it to them?



No. The Scots didn't "chose to give up their sovereignty to the
English Parliament and become part of the United Kingdom".

The Scottish and English Parliaments both voted themselves out of
existence (in 1707) in favour of a new *British* Parliament. The
United Kingdom came into being 104 years earlier (in 1603) when James
the 6th of Scotland became James the 1st of Great Britain (note,
*not* James the 1st of England). The English educational system has
never been on the ball regarding what really happened!

The English view of course is that the English Parliament absorbed
Scotland, not true............
